Symptoms

  • •Oil spots or puddles under the vehicle
  • •Burning oil smell, especially after the engine is turned off
  • •Engine oil level dropping noticeably
  • •Smoke rising from the engine bay
  • •Check engine light illuminated (if oil level is critically low)

Solution
1. Preparation
  • Gather all necessary tools and parts.
  • Ensure the vehicle is parked on a level surface and the engine is cool.
2. Inspect and Replace Gaskets
  • Sub-steps:
    • Valve Cover Gasket:
      1. Remove the engine cover if applicable.
      2. Disconnect any electrical connectors or hoses blocking access to the valve cover.
      3. Unscrew the valve cover bolts using a socket set.
      4. Carefully lift off the valve cover and inspect the old gasket.
      5. Clean the mating surfaces of the valve cover and engine.
      6. Install a new valve cover gasket and reassemble the valve cover.
    • Oil Filter and Drain Plug:
      1. Use an oil filter wrench to remove the old oil filter.
      2. Apply a thin layer of clean oil to the rubber gasket of the new oil filter.
      3. Install the new oil filter and tighten it by hand.
      4. Place a new washer on the oil drain plug and tighten it to the manufacturer's torque specifications.
3. Inspect Oil Pan and Seals
  • Sub-steps:
    • Oil Pan:
      1. If the oil pan is leaking, remove the bolts securing it to the engine block.
      2. Carefully slide the oil pan off and discard the old gasket.
      3. Clean the mating surfaces of the oil pan and the engine.
      4. Install a new gasket and reattach the oil pan, tightening the bolts to specifications.
    • Main Seals:
      1. If leaks are detected at the front or rear main seals, the engine may need to be lifted slightly to access these seals.
      2. Remove the necessary components (e.g., crankshaft pulley, flywheel) to access the seals.
      3. Replace the seals carefully and ensure they are seated properly.
